bg 1x1 u112389264 [ nena224 ] Onlyfans leaked photo 5411485 on Hotleaks.tv

u112389264 [ nena224 ] Onlyfans leaked photo 5411485

Give it a kiss
3.4K views2 years ago
View More
Back to Top